ABOUT THE JOB:

At Danone, Manufacturing the best products and supplying them to meet demand is a key driver for our plant teams. We have an opening for a Continuous Improvement Manager in our West Jordan, Utah yogurt manufacturing facility. In this role, you will lead the continuous improvement program and be responsible for driving a culture of continuous improvement and driving operational excellence to all areas of the site. This includes defining the CI strategy for the site in execution of Danone’s CI program (DaMaWay), coaching site leaders in execution of CI programs, and being a hands-on servant leader to enable change management in the plant. The CI Manager must be a change catalyst with strong communication and time management skills and an ability to quickly flow between strategic thinking and tactical coaching and execution. The CI manager is responsible to lead the development of the hourly professionals to embrace the DaMaWay culture.


In this role, you will:

  • Own and manage the overall CI Program in the site ensuring effectiveness of change management, adoption of systems and culture, integration across pillars and functions, and delivery of all result areas
  • Acts as an internal partner for the site to lead, define, develop, and coach continuous improvement activities to drive improvement in all result areas and KPI’s to meet the business needs
  • Be a partner, coach, and mentor to site pillar leaders and teams in EHS, Quality, Autonomous Maintenance, Planned Maintenance, Organization, and Education & Training
  • Own and manage the Focused Improvement Pillar in the site defining the problem-solving capability, tools, and strategy across the site as well as coaching the execution and implementing countermeasures and driving action plans to resolution
  • Support and at times leads problem-solving efforts to improve safety, quality, delivery and eliminate waste/cost at the local level
  • Identify key opportunities for process improvement and partners with process owners to lead activities to deliver sustainable and repeatable change and improve business results
  • Develop and prepare metrics and reports to drive action and change through the CI program
  • Conduct regular and periodic audits and health checks of the Site CI Program and each pillar
  • Facilitate the development of action plans to variances as identified through the audit process
  • Coach and facilitate the site strategic planning process (glidepath) in collaboration with the site leadership team and ensures consistent adherence to the process including monthly scorecard reporting, data accuracy owner (CUTE), and gap analysis
  • Identify and leverage best practices across the plant and shares broadly across the network CI team to improve standards and guidelines for company DaMaWay program implementation
  • Own the losses initiative by conducting regular audits and supporting initiatives across the plant
  • Manage the site productivity process and pipeline to deliver savings vs. commitment
  • Coach and mentor Process engineers across the site

ABOUT YOU:

  • You have a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Business, or other related field with at least five years related experience in operations or process improvement within a manufacturing environment, required. Equivalent work experience and training will be considered in lieu of a degree. A high school diploma or GED is required. Lean, TPM, or Six Sigma certification is a plus.
  • You have knowledge of CI / Lean tools and TPM experience and knowledge with practical application of AM, PM, FI, Education & Training systems and tools
  • You have Knowledge of principles and methods for process improvement and experience leading problem solving and process improvement efforts, required
  • You have knowledge of business and management principles involved in strategic planning, resource allocation, leadership, production methods, and coordination of people and resources
  • You have strong project and program management skills, as well as facilitation and communication skills for problem solving events, productivity ideation, etc.
  • You have excellent multi-tasking, organization, and time-management skills
  • You have experience and ability to influence others without positional authority
